How to resize image canvas to maintain square aspect ratio in Python OpenCv

0 votes
I'd like to get a 1000 x 1000 picture in Python from any input picture so that the input doesn't lost it's aspect ratio. With other words, I want to resize the input so that its longer dimension be 1000 pixels and "fill" the other dimension with the background color until it become 1000 x 1000 square. The original must be in the center at the end.

Building on Alexander-Reynolds answer above, here is the code that handles all possible sizes and situations.

def resizeAndPad(img, size, padColor=255):

h, w = img.shape[:2]
sh, sw = size

# interpolation method
if h > sh or w > sw: # shrinking image
    interp = cv2.INTER_AREA

else: # stretching image
    interp = cv2.INTER_CUBIC

# aspect ratio of image
aspect = float(w)/h 
saspect = float(sw)/sh

if (saspect > aspect) or ((saspect == 1) and (aspect <= 1)):  # new horizontal image
    new_h = sh
    new_w = np.round(new_h * aspect).astype(int)
    pad_horz = float(sw - new_w) / 2
    pad_left, pad_right = np.floor(pad_horz).astype(int), np.ceil(pad_horz).astype(int)
    pad_top, pad_bot = 0, 0

elif (saspect < aspect) or ((saspect == 1) and (aspect >= 1)):  # new vertical image
    new_w = sw
    new_h = np.round(float(new_w) / aspect).astype(int)
    pad_vert = float(sh - new_h) / 2
    pad_top, pad_bot = np.floor(pad_vert).astype(int), np.ceil(pad_vert).astype(int)
    pad_left, pad_right = 0, 0

# set pad color
if len(img.shape) is 3 and not isinstance(padColor, (list, tuple, np.ndarray)): # color image but only one color provided
    padColor = [padColor]*3

# scale and pad
scaled_img = cv2.resize(img, (new_w, new_h), interpolation=interp)
scaled_img = cv2.copyMakeBorder(scaled_img, pad_top, pad_bot, pad_left, pad_right, borderType=cv2.BORDER_CONSTANT, value=padColor)

return scaled_img
